Types Of Guinea Visa

visa

Guinea visas have three types based on the purpose of travel. The Tourist eVisa is issued for sightseeing and leisure, hence visitors can stay for a maximum of 90 days. The Business eVisa, also valid for 90 days, is used for attending conferences, meetings and other commercial engagements. Lastly, the Transit eVisa permits a short stay of up to 3 days for travelers passing through the country. All the visa types are single entry and are easy to get through Guinea's official eVisa site.

Guinea Visa Document Required

Collect all the documents needed for the eVisa application before starting the procedure on the portal. Submitting a passport which is valid at least six months from the date of intended travel, is one of the critical documents. Moreover, there is a need to include a compliant passport sized photograph. 

Additionally, the certificate of vaccination for yellow fever and other documents such as flight booking for onward or return travel must be included as well as other documents that substantiate self-sufficiency during the stay. Depending on the type of visa sought, many other documents may be necessary. 

An invitation letter from a Guinean registered company is compulsory for business travelers. Tourists are also required to submit hotel reservations or a complete travel itinerary. All signatures of the required documents must be scanned and submitted electronically, which makes clarity imperative. Compliance with these requirements is mandatory to avoid unnecessary delays or rejection.

Widen Your World – Visa-Free Guinea Travel for Citizens

Guinea has signed passport freedom treaties with some countries so as to facilitate access for short term travelers. ECOWAS nationals like Nigeria, Ghana, Côte d’Ivoire, and Singaporean citizens are allowed to visit Guinea visa-free for up to 30 days. They only require a passport, proof of further travel, and a vaccination certificate for yellow fever.

All travelers are subject to health and immigration regulations upon arrival. Even citizens of countries that do not require a visa for certain purposes must obtain an official eVisa if traveling for other reasons.

Guinea Facts and Figures

Official Name: Republic of Guinea
Capital: Conakry
Population (2022 est.) 13,269,000
Head Of State President: Col. Mamady Doumbouya (interim)1
Official Language French
Official Religion none
Urban-Rural: (2018) 35.9%
Population Rank: (2022) 76
